1. 首页 > 科技

css相关,如何达到我想要的效果? css超链接点击后变色

css相关,如何达到我想要的效果?css超链接点击后变色

css怎么实现这效果。--看图

这个和你想要实现的效果比较相似,你可以把代码拷贝出来,把上面的图片换成你自己的,效果应该差不大多

www.lanrentuku/js/nav-106.html

css 鼠标点击后变色,点下一个连接,上一个怎么变回来啊 ? www.hfty/products.asp?treeid=51

这个是用javascript控制的。非常简单。复制到body里面试下。

<script>

function left_btn(n)

{

var a_num=document.getElementById("left_btn_box").getElementsByTagName("a");

for(i=0;i{

a_num[i].className=i==n?"select":"";

}

}

</script>

按钮1

按钮2

按钮3

CSS2.1中如何实现text-overflow的效果

语法:

text-overflow : clip | ellipsis

参数:

clip : 不显示省略标记(...),而是简单的裁切

ellipsis : 当对象内文本溢出时显示省略标记(...)

说明:

设置或检索是否使用一个省略标记(...)标示对象内文本的溢出。

对应的脚本特性为textOverflow。请参阅我编写的其他书目。

示例:

div { text-overflow : clip; }

看起来不错,我们测试一下

<div style="width:100px;height:20px;text-overflow:ellipsis; ">a b c d e f g h i j k l , msa sd sd sa w df f </div>

<div style="width:100px;height:20px;text-overflow:ellipsis; white-space:nowrap; overflow:hidden; ">a b c d e f g h i j k l , msa sd sd sa w df f </div>

这个时候显示的就是正常的了

text-overflow属性仅是注解,当文本溢出时是否显示省略标记。并不具备其它的样式属性定义。我们想要实现溢出时产生省略号的效果。还必须定义:强制文本在一行内显示(white-space:nowrap)及溢出内容为隐藏(overflow:hidden)。只有这样才能实现溢出文本显示省略号的效果。

一、仅定义text-overflow:ellipsis; 不能实现省略号效果。

二、定义text-overflow:ellipsis; white-space:nowrap; 同样不能实现省略号效果

三、按52css的教程,即本文所讲的方法,同时应用: text-overflow:ellipsis; white-space:nowrap; overflow:hidden; 实现了所想要得到的溢出文本显示省略号效果:

网页制作怎么达到如下效果: 浏览器缩放时网页保持不变,不仅图片大小不变,布局位置也不变。 我现在出

自适应代码,用框写。

浏览器变化时,布局会发生变化,你要做的不是不变化,而是自动重新布局